Cherry Pie Cookies Feathers in the woods

Preheat oven to 375 degrees F. Transfer cookies to parchment lined baking sheet. Place frozen cookies on baking sheet; about 1 inch apart. Fill each center of the cookie with 1 cherry. Bake for 12 minutes. Remove cookies from oven and top with an additional 1-2 cherries. Bake an additional 2 minutes in oven.

Chocolate Cherry Thumbprint Cookies Julie's Eats & Treats

Preheat oven to 350°F. Spray mini muffin pans with nonstick baking spray (the kind with flour) or grease and flour the pans. Don't skip this step or your cookies will stick. Place one cookie dough ball in each muffin pan cavity. Bake 18-22 minutes or until the cookies are fully baked.

Unbelievably easy recipe for a pretty, super yummy and festive holiday

Place two cherries in each indent. Bake the cookies at 350°F for 10 to 12 minutes and then cool them on the cookie sheet for two minutes. Transfer them to a cooling rack to cool completely. Melt the almond bark following the package instructions. Drizzle the melted chocolate over the cookies.
